I believe it is never too late for change and recovery. If you have been struggling for a long time and find yourself looking for help with a difficult situation or feelings you that you have been facing, let’s connect together.
I understand how hard it is to be a human and how our histories, relationships, and structural oppression impact our health and wellness. I am a firm believer that we grow throughout the lifespan and that it is never too late for change and recovery.
As an artist, I understand the healing properties inherent in art making, and as a trained, licensed and board certified art therapist, I understand how to use various art making materials
and methods to tap into clients inner selves in a way that talk therapy sometimes misses. That is not to say that everyone I work with wants to do art therapy. I also use an eclectic, existential and social justice oriented lens to
understand the many layers of the human experience. I help clients find meaning and joy moving forward.

With extensive training and experience in mental health treatment for crisis, trauma, and intensive symptoms, I draw from years of supporting situations to pace with you. I also have
training in perinatal mood disorders and am pursuing certification for perinatal mental health to support families through growth, loss, hardship, and these stressful transitions.
I am particularly interested in working with folks struggling with identity (LGBTQIA+, white guilt, and major life changes which change how we think about ourselves), depression and anxiety, trauma, and people who are embarking on the parenting journey.
I am solution focused and believe that you are the expert of your life. I am here as a mirror and confidant to help you discover the next right steps for you.
